Price to rent ratio

Price to rent ratio (p/r) is discovered when you start with the median property price and divide it by the yearly median gross rent. A market with high rental rates should have a low p/r. You need a low p/r and higher rents that can pay off your property more quickly. Look out for a really low p/r, which could make it more costly to lease a residence than to acquire one. You may lose tenants to the home buying market that will increase the number of your vacant investment properties. Nonetheless, lower p/r indicators are generally more preferred than high ratios.

Long Term Rental (BRRRR)

A long-term rental strategy that includes Buying a property, Renovating, Renting, Refinancing it, and Repeating the process by employing the money from the mortgage refinance is called BRRRR. BRRRR is a system for consistent expansion. It is a must that you be able to receive a “cash-out” mortgage refinance for the plan to work.

You add to the value of the property beyond what you spent acquiring and renovating the property. The rental is refinanced based on the ARV and the balance, or equity, comes to you in cash. You employ that money to purchase an additional investment property and the operation begins again. You add improving assets to the portfolio and lease revenue to your cash flow.

Short-Term Rental Cash-on-Cash Return

A short-term rental’s cash-on-cash return will inform you if the investment is a reasonable use of your own funds. Divide the Net Operating Income (NOI) by the total amount of cash put in. The resulting percentage is your cash-on-cash return. When a venture is high-paying enough to reclaim the investment budget promptly, you will receive a high percentage. If you borrow part of the investment budget and use less of your own money, you will see a higher cash-on-cash return.

Average Short-Term Rental Capitalization (Cap) Rates

Average short-term rental capitalization (cap) rates are commonly utilized by real property investors to evaluate the worth of rental units. An investment property that has a high cap rate and charges typical market rental rates has a good value. When investment properties in a city have low cap rates, they typically will cost more money. Divide your estimated Net Operating Income (NOI) by the property’s value or listing price. The percentage you get is the investment property’s cap rate.

Wholesaling

As a real estate wholesaler, you sign a contract to buy a house that other real estate investors will want. An investor then “buys” the sale and purchase agreement from you. The property is bought by the real estate investor, not the wholesaler. You’re selling the rights to the contract, not the home itself.

Mortgage Note Investing

Buying mortgage notes (loans) works when the mortgage loan can be bought for less than the remaining balance. The borrower makes subsequent payments to the investor who has become their new mortgage lender.

When a loan is being repaid on time, it’s considered a performing loan. These notes are a stable provider of cash flow. Non-performing loans can be restructured or you can acquire the collateral for less than face value by completing foreclosure.

Foreclosure Laws

Successful mortgage note investors are completely aware of their state’s regulations for foreclosure. Are you faced with a mortgage or a Deed of Trust? Lenders might have to get the court’s okay to foreclose on a mortgage note’s collateral. You only have to file a public notice and proceed with foreclosure process if you’re using a Deed of Trust.

Mortgage Interest Rates

Note investors inherit the interest rate of the mortgage loan notes that they acquire. Your mortgage note investment return will be impacted by the interest rate. Interest rates are critical to both performing and non-performing note investors.

Conventional interest rates can differ by up to a 0.25% across the United States. Private loan rates can be a little more than conventional mortgage rates because of the higher risk taken by private lenders.

Note investors ought to always know the present local mortgage interest rates, private and traditional, in potential investment markets.

Property Taxes

Escrows for real estate taxes are usually given to the lender simultaneously with the mortgage loan payment. By the time the property taxes are due, there needs to be sufficient money being held to take care of them. The lender will need to compensate if the mortgage payments halt or the lender risks tax liens on the property. If taxes are past due, the government’s lien supersedes any other liens to the head of the line and is paid first.

Because property tax escrows are combined with the mortgage payment, growing taxes indicate larger mortgage loan payments. Homeowners who have trouble making their mortgage payments may drop farther behind and ultimately default.

Syndications

When people collaborate by investing capital and creating a group to hold investment real estate, it’s referred to as a syndication. One individual structures the deal and invites the others to participate.

The organizer of the syndication is called the Syndicator or Sponsor. The sponsor is responsible for handling the acquisition or construction and generating income. They are also responsible for distributing the actual revenue to the rest of the partners.

The other participants in a syndication invest passively. The company agrees to provide them a preferred return when the company is turning a profit. These partners have no obligations concerned with managing the partnership or running the operation of the assets.

Ownership Interest

Every participant owns a piece of the partnership. Everyone who puts cash into the partnership should expect to own more of the partnership than those who do not.

As a cash investor, you should also expect to receive a preferred return on your funds before income is distributed. Preferred return is a percentage of the capital invested that is disbursed to capital investors out of net revenues. After the preferred return is paid, the remainder of the net revenues are distributed to all the members.

If syndication’s assets are sold at a profit, it’s distributed among the participants. The total return on an investment like this can significantly grow when asset sale net proceeds are combined with the yearly revenues from a successful Syndication. REITs

Many real estate investment firms are structured as a trust called Real Estate Investment Trusts or REITs. This was originally invented as a method to allow the typical investor to invest in real estate. REIT shares are economical for most people.

Shareholders’ involvement in a REIT falls under passive investment. The liability that the investors are accepting is spread within a selection of investment real properties. Shares in a REIT can be liquidated when it is beneficial for you. But REIT investors do not have the option to choose specific properties or locations. Their investment is limited to the assets owned by the REIT.

Real Estate Investment Funds

A Real Estate Investment Fund is a mutual fund that owns stocks of real estate businesses. The investment properties are not possessed by the fund — they are possessed by the companies the fund invests in. This is an additional method for passive investors to diversify their investments with real estate avoiding the high entry-level investment or liability. Investment funds are not obligated to pay dividends unlike a REIT. The worth of a fund to an investor is the expected appreciation of the worth of the fund’s shares.

You can select a fund that focuses on a specific kind of real estate company, such as commercial, but you can’t choose the fund’s investment properties or locations. You have to count on the fund’s managers to decide which locations and real estate properties are picked for investment.
